About Us
We are Nurtur. We are an innovative startup focused on revolutionizing maternal mental health care through technology and data-driven solutions. Our mission is to empower and nurture mothers by providing AI-powered solutions. We seek a visionary and results-oriented Chief Technology Officer (CTO) to join our leadership team and drive the strategic direction and execution of our product roadmap. This is a Fractional role with the possibility of converting to full-time in the future.
Responsibilities
1. Product Vision and Execution
- Lead the AI vision: Drive the strategic direction of nurtur’s AI technologies, including generative AI with structured and LLM-driven chatbot development. Sensitivity to challenges in LLM-driven products such as hallucinations and data security and ability to tackle these.
- Define product direction: Partner with the CEO and product team to translate business goals into a clear product roadmap, that aligns with the company’s goals, drives growth, and ensures market fit and user adoption.
- Own the product lifecylce: Lead all stages of product development, from ideation and design to implementation and ongoing optimization.
- Manage feedback loops: Establish robust processes for gathering and incorporating user and stakeholder feedback to continuously improve nurtur’s offerings.
- Experience in HIPAA compliance and ability to work with PHI.
2. Technical Leadership and Execution
- Architect and build scalable AI infrastructure: Design and implement secure, scalable, and maintainable AI infrastructure to support nurtur’s growth.
- Wear multiple hats: Be prepared to handle non-core CTO tasks in nurtur’s early stages, such as coding, bug fixing, and basic infrastructure management, while delegating and automating when possible.
- Experiment with cutting-edge ML: Foster a culture of innovation, leading research and experimentation with advanced ML algorithms and tools to maximize efficacy and user experience.
- Own tech stack and architecture: Oversee the codebase and technical architecture of nurtur’s products, ensuring code quality, efficiency, and adherence to best practices.
- Experiment with data science prototypes and application of appropriate ML algorithms and tools.
- Champion data science integration: Collaborate with data scientists to translate insights into actionable technical solutions that improve nurtur’s effectiveness and provide engagement and other metrics of product utilization and UX.
- Stay updated with the latest industry trends and advancements in digital rights management, generative AI, content identification and compliance, content security, and identity management.
- Prioritize: Focus on critical tasks that only you can do, like setting the technology vision, architecting the platform, and leading fundraising efforts for tech initiatives.

Requirements
- 10+ years of experience in software development, technical leadership, or product management roles, preferably within the healthcare and/or AI sectors.
- 5+ years of experience building and leading teams in the development and implementation of AI solutions.
- Proven track record of success in delivering innovative and impactful products using AI technologies like generative AI, LLMs, and ML algorithms.
- Deep understanding of the challenges and opportunities in applying AI to the healthcare domain, specifically around maternal mental health.
- Experience in building and scaling secure and reliable AI infrastructure that complies with relevant data privacy regulations.
- Strong leadership skills with the ability to motivate and inspire a team of talented engineers and data scientists.
- Experience working with chatbots or conversational AI systems.
- Excellent communication skills to effectively collaborate with cross-functional teams, stakeholders, and external partners.
- Demonstrated ability to translate business goals into technical roadmaps and deliver on strategic objectives.
- Passion for nurturing and empowering mothers through technology and innovation.
Preferred skills
- PhD in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ence, or a related field or equivalent level of experience.
- Public speaking experience and industry reputation in the AI community.
